u007f数据库是什么
-
u007f数据库是一种基于区块链技术的分布式数据库。它采用了去中心化的方式,将数据存储在多个节点上,而不是集中存储在一个中心服务器上。每个节点都有完整的数据库副本,并且通过共识算法来保持数据的一致性和安全性。
u007f数据库具有以下特点:
-
去中心化:u007f数据库没有中心化的控制节点,数据存储在多个节点上。这种去中心化的结构使得数据库更加安全和可靠,没有单一故障点,也不容易被攻击或篡改。
-
分布式存储:u007f数据库将数据分布存储在多个节点上,每个节点都有完整的数据库副本。这种分布式存储结构可以提高数据库的容错性和可扩展性,当有新的节点加入时,数据库可以自动进行数据的复制和同步。
-
共识算法:u007f数据库通过共识算法来保持数据的一致性。共识算法是一种用于在分布式系统中达成一致意见的协议,它可以确保每个节点都按照相同的规则更新数据库,从而避免数据的不一致性和冲突。
-
安全性:u007f数据库采用了密码学技术来保护数据的安全性。每个节点都有自己的私钥和公钥,私钥用于对数据进行签名和加密,公钥用于验证数据的真实性。这种安全机制可以防止数据被篡改和伪造。
-
可追溯性:u007f数据库记录了每个数据的完整历史,包括创建时间、修改时间和操作者等信息。这种可追溯性可以帮助用户追踪和审计数据的来源和变更,增加数据的可信度和透明度。
总之,u007f数据库是一种创新的分布式数据库,它通过去中心化、分布式存储、共识算法、安全性和可追溯性等特点,提供了更安全、可靠和透明的数据存储和管理解决方案。
1年前 -
-
Unicode数据库(Unicode Database)是Unicode标准中定义的一种数据集合,用于存储和管理各种字符的相关信息。Unicode是一种国际字符编码标准,它为世界上几乎所有的文字系统提供了一个统一的编码方案,以便在计算机和其他电子设备上进行字符的表示和处理。
Unicode数据库包含了各种字符的编码信息,包括字符的代码点、字符名称、字符分类(如字母、数字、标点符号等)、字符的大小写转换信息、字符的音调和重音信息、字符的字形信息等。这些信息对于字符的显示、输入、搜索和处理都非常重要。
Unicode数据库由Unicode Consortium(Unicode协会)维护和更新,它是一个非营利性组织,由各个领域的专家组成,致力于推动和维护Unicode标准。Unicode数据库每年都会进行更新,以添加新的字符和修复已有字符的问题。
Unicode数据库在计算机系统中起到了至关重要的作用。操作系统、编程语言、应用软件等都需要使用Unicode数据库来正确地处理和显示各种字符。无论是在电子邮件、网页浏览、文档编辑还是数据库管理等方面,Unicode数据库都是必不可少的基础设施。
总之,Unicode数据库是Unicode标准中定义的一种数据集合,用于存储和管理各种字符的相关信息。它在计算机系统中起到了至关重要的作用,是实现国际化和多语言支持的基础。
1年前 -
u007f数据库是一种关系型数据库管理系统(RDBMS),它以表格的形式存储数据,并使用结构化查询语言(SQL)进行数据管理。它是一种开源软件,广泛应用于各种规模的企业和组织。
u007f数据库的特点包括:
-
关系型数据库:u007f数据库采用关系模型来组织数据,数据以表格(表)的形式存储,每个表由多个行(记录)和列(字段)组成。表之间可以通过主键和外键建立关联关系。
-
ACID事务:u007f数据库支持ACID(原子性、一致性、隔离性和持久性)事务,确保数据的完整性和一致性。
-
多用户并发访问:u007f数据库可以同时支持多个用户对数据库的并发访问,通过锁机制和事务隔离级别来保证数据的一致性。
-
数据完整性约束:u007f数据库支持定义各种数据完整性约束,如主键约束、唯一约束、外键约束和检查约束,以保证数据的准确性和完整性。
-
强大的查询功能:u007f数据库提供了丰富的查询语言(SQL)和查询优化器,可以高效地执行复杂的查询操作,包括聚合函数、连接、子查询等。
-
扩展性和可靠性:u007f数据库支持水平和垂直扩展,可以根据需求增加数据库的容量和性能。同时,u007f数据库具有高可靠性和容错性,支持数据备份和恢复。
下面是使用u007f数据库的操作流程:
-
安装和配置:首先需要下载u007f数据库的安装包,并按照指导进行安装。安装完成后,需要进行数据库的初始化和配置,包括设置数据库的存储路径、端口号、用户权限等。
-
创建数据库:在u007f数据库中,可以创建多个数据库来存储不同的数据。使用SQL语句"CREATE DATABASE"可以创建一个新的数据库。
-
创建表:在数据库中创建表格来存储数据。使用SQL语句"CREATE TABLE"可以定义表的结构,包括表名、列名、数据类型和约束。
-
插入数据:使用SQL语句"INSERT INTO"可以向表中插入数据。需要指定要插入的表名和要插入的数据。
-
查询数据:使用SQL语句"SELECT"可以从表中查询数据。可以指定要查询的列、条件、排序等。
-
更新数据:使用SQL语句"UPDATE"可以更新表中的数据。需要指定要更新的表名、要更新的列和更新后的值,还可以添加更新条件。
-
删除数据:使用SQL语句"DELETE FROM"可以删除表中的数据。需要指定要删除的表名和删除条件。
-
数据备份和恢复:为了保证数据的安全性,需要定期对数据库进行备份。可以使用u007f数据库提供的备份工具进行全量备份和增量备份。在需要恢复数据时,可以使用备份文件进行数据恢复。
-
性能优化:对于大型数据库,为了提高查询性能,可以进行索引和分区等优化操作。可以使用SQL语句"CREATE INDEX"创建索引,使用SQL语句"CREATE PARTITION"进行分区。
-
监控和维护:定期监控数据库的性能和运行状态,可以使用u007f数据库提供的监控工具或第三方监控工具。同时,还需要进行数据库的维护工作,包括优化查询语句、清理无用数据、重新索引等。
总结:u007f数据库是一种功能强大的关系型数据库管理系统,可以用于存储和管理各种类型的数据。通过合理的操作流程和优化手段,可以提高数据库的性能和稳定性,满足企业和组织对数据管理的需求。
1年前 -